About This Call
This exhibition invites artists to submit work depicting domestic and working animals in all mediums. Artists may submit up to two works for consideration. Only work not previously shown at Salmagundi is eligible.
Accepted works must be professionally framed with wire for hanging, with outside frame dimensions not exceeding 40 inches. Artists are responsible for providing accurate images of their unframed work for submission; if accepted, they will be sent instructions to provide images of their framed work. Works must be received by the stated dates to be hung in the exhibition. Acceptance and rejection notifications will be sent via ShowSubmit.
Submissions must include high-quality JPEG images at least 1900 pixels on the longest edge with a maximum file size of 30 MB. Images should show only the artwork itself without matting, frames, or background distractions, and must be oriented correctly. Entry fees are non-refundable and must be submitted by the deadline. After acceptance, works being shipped must be sent in reusable shipping boxes for art with the exhibition name on the outside; artists not using reusable boxes will incur a $35 unpacking/packing charge. A return shipping label must be provided by the artist if work is to be shipped back after the exhibition. Works must be removed immediately after the exhibition. The club retains 30% of all sales, with 70% going to the artist. If work is not for sale, artists should write "NFS" on the hangtag included in the acceptance email.
